Pokemon GO has revealed the debut of the Gen 9 Steel-type creature Orthworm for the upcoming Steeled Resolve event arriving in late April. As the game approaches its 10th anniversary, Pokemon GO players have a ton of exciting limited events to look forward to over the next few months. The ongoing Memories in Motion season has brought some long-awaited debuts in March, including Gigantamax Pikachu and Blipbug. The AR game has already confirmed that April will also feature more monster releases.
April was off to a strong start for Pokemon GO fans. For April Fools' Day, Pokemon GO debuted the fan-favorite Mimikyu with no previous warning. The Ghost-Fairy-type started spawning in the wild as part of the A Shockingly Good Time event. Later, on April 4, the game hosted a Fashion Raid Day event with over ten costumed Pokemon available. Now, a returning limited event centered around Steel-type monsters is coming, featuring the debut of a popular earthworm Pokemon from Pokemon Scarlet and Violet.
